According to Scene size-up, It is important not to simply rush into a patient's house when you arrive on the scene as the scene should be sized up for threats and violence.
<h3><u>
What is Scene size-up?</u></h3>
- Sizing-up the scene, or identifying whether there are any risks present that may influence responders, anyone connected to the incident, or the community at large, is more important than all other concepts taught throughout EMS training.
- Recognize that scene size-up should start as soon as you report for any assigned shift and should start prior to any calls for the day.
- Responders should mentally and physically get ready for any potential calls after assessing the conditions for a given shift: Verify that all personal protective equipment is present and in good working order.
- Review the additional resources that are accessible as well as how to get in touch with them if necessary.
- Before beginning any further tasks, the complex process of "scene size-up" takes place both before and right away after arriving at the area.
The goal of scene size-up is to quickly confirm that there is a secure location on which to deliver care and that the appropriate resources are called in in accordance with the number of patients and their individual care requirements.

Linear Programming is an optimization technique used in a system with multiple constraints that requires a solution. While not always optimal (even though it strives to be), the solution is at least feasible and adequate in managing limited resources in production, for example. LP will, in that sense, always have a single goal specified, trying to simplify a problem with multiple variables.
